IGEL Cloud Gateway (ICG) and Asset Inventory Tracker (AIT) are solely available in a subscription model. The customer aquires a license for the duration of 1 or 3 years. Licences come in quantities of 10 endpoint devices.

A valid subscription entitles the customer to

  • initially activate the subscription in the IGEL License Portal (ILP) at activation.igel.com, which starts the subscription period,
  • install the latest product release and its predecessors,
  • use the product to register and connect the specified number of devices,
  • obtain free support for the product from the IGEL Help Desk.

    On license expiry, the customer cannot continue using the product.

The following allows for added flexibility in ICG licensing:

  • To free licenses, customers may remove devices registered via ICG in the UMS when they no longer need an ICG registration.
  • Within the maintenance period, customers may buy additional licenses for the remaining time.

An ICG license is tied to a specific UMS installation, be it one single host or a cluster, by the unique Cluster ID. This assignment is established when the license is generated in the IGEL License Portal.
